首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JavaScript!创造一个猜词游戏

JavaScript是一种广泛应用于Web开发的脚本语言,它可以在网页中实现动态交互和丰富的用户体验。以下是关于JavaScript的完善且全面的答案:

概念:

JavaScript是一种高级、解释型的编程语言,由Netscape公司(现Mozilla基金会)开发并于1995年首次发布。它主要用于在网页中实现动态效果、交互功能和数据处理。JavaScript可以直接嵌入到HTML页面中,并通过浏览器解释执行。

分类:

JavaScript属于脚本语言的一种,与编译型语言(如C++、Java)不同,它不需要经过编译过程,而是在运行时由浏览器解释执行。JavaScript也可以被归类为面向对象语言,因为它支持对象、类和继承等概念。

优势:

  1. 客户端脚本语言:JavaScript主要运行在客户端,可以直接在用户的浏览器中执行,无需服务器端的支持。
  2. 跨平台兼容性:JavaScript可以在几乎所有的现代浏览器上运行,包括桌面和移动设备,具有良好的跨平台兼容性。
  3. 动态交互和用户体验:JavaScript可以通过DOM(文档对象模型)操作网页元素,实现动态交互和实时更新,提升用户体验。
  4. 轻量级和易学习:JavaScript语法相对简单,学习曲线较低,适合初学者入门,并且JavaScript文件通常较小,加载速度快。

应用场景:

  1. 网页交互和动态效果:JavaScript可以用于实现网页中的表单验证、动画效果、轮播图、下拉菜单等交互功能,提升用户体验。
  2. 数据处理和AJAX:JavaScript可以通过AJAX技术与服务器进行异步通信,实现数据的动态加载和处理,例如实时搜索、无刷新评论等。
  3. 前端框架和库:JavaScript有许多流行的前端框架和库,如React、Vue.js和jQuery,用于简化开发过程、提高效率和代码质量。
  4. 游戏开发:JavaScript可以通过HTML5的Canvas和WebGL技术实现简单的网页游戏,如小游戏、拼图等。
  5. 浏览器插件和扩展:JavaScript可以用于开发浏览器插件和扩展,为浏览器增加额外的功能和定制化选项。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列与JavaScript开发相关的产品和服务,包括:

  1. 云服务器(CVM):提供灵活可扩展的云服务器实例,可用于部署和运行JavaScript应用。了解更多:云服务器
  2. 云函数(SCF):无服务器计算服务,可以在云端运行JavaScript代码,实现事件驱动的应用程序。了解更多:云函数
  3. 云存储(COS):提供安全可靠的对象存储服务,可用于存储JavaScript应用中的静态资源和文件。了解更多:云存储
  4. 云数据库MySQL(CMYSQL):提供高性能、可扩展的云数据库服务,可用于存储和管理JavaScript应用的数据。了解更多:云数据库MySQL
  5. 云监控(Cloud Monitor):提供全方位的云资源监控和告警服务,可用于监控JavaScript应用的性能和运行状态。了解更多:云监控

请注意,以上推荐的产品和服务仅为示例,您可以根据具体需求选择适合的腾讯云产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

用OpenCV实现游戏

小伙伴们是不是在用OpenCV来处理图像处理的相关任务,从来没有想过还可以通过OpenCV设计一款游戏,今天小白将为各位小伙伴们介绍如何通过OpenCV创建一个的小游戏。...为了增加趣味性,我们给小游戏起了一个比较具有故事性的名字“刽子手游戏(Hangman)”,我们先来看一下该游戏的视频。...这是一个电影名字的游戏,会在屏幕下方显示电影的单词数目以及每个单词的字母个数,我们需要电影名字中含有的字母,如果猜测错误,右侧的刽子手处就会依次出现人头、身体、手和脚等,当错6次之后,刽子手就会行动...,游戏就输了。...我们将在这里再添一个。我们将显示以红色输入的有效字符,以便用户可以看到他们输入的字符。

68020

一个 ECharts 做的数小游戏

大概 1 年多之前,一位老同学找到我,问能不能帮他做一个非常简单的数字游戏,需求是这样的: 在 1 到 100 的整数里,随机选一个数字,让小朋友们; 如果错了,告知小朋友大了还是小了; 如果猜中了...,游戏结束。...,去掉直角坐标系的坐标轴(xAxis.show = false, yAxis.show = false),去掉仪表盘指针和刻度值(axisLabel.show = false)等; 点击热力图数...// 设置一个变量,如果猜对了将其赋值为 1 var flag = 0; //监听点击事件,在猜中之前进行响应,params.data[2]就是所的数字 myChart.on('click', function...与预先生成的随机数比对,根据比对结果提供刷新图表的参数: 是否猜中,1 代表猜中,0 代表没猜中; 提示信息; 新的数范围最小值; 新的数范围最大值。

50540

❤️创意网页:贪吃蛇游戏 - 创造一个经典的小游戏

今天,我们将一起学习如何使用HTML5 Canvas和JavaScript创造一个经典的小游戏 - 贪吃蛇游戏。我们将会为您提供代码解析以及游戏玩法说明。让我们开始吧!...代码将在下面添加 创造贪吃蛇游戏 我们已经有了一个基本的HTML结构,其中包含一个Canvas元素用于绘制游戏画面。...接下来,我们将添加JavaScript代码来创造贪吃蛇游戏。...运行游戏 现在,将上述HTML代码保存为一个HTML文件,并在浏览器中打开它。您将会看到一个黑色边框的画布,即游戏的主界面。使用方向键控制蛇的运动,吃掉食物,并尝试不要碰到画布边界或自身。 <!...创造一个经典的小游戏 - 贪吃蛇游戏

19010

2022-03-09:我们正在玩一个游戏游戏规则如下: 我

2022-03-09:我们正在玩一个游戏游戏规则如下: 我从 1 到 n 之间选择一个数字。 你来猜我选了哪个数字。 如果你猜到正确的数字,就会 赢得游戏 。...如果你错了,那么我会告诉你,我选的数字比你的 更大或者更小 ,并且你需要继续数。 每当你了数字 x 并且错了的时候,你需要支付金额为 x 的现金。 如果你花光了钱,就会 输掉游戏 。...给你一个特定的数字 n ,返回能够 确保你获胜 的最小现金数,不管我选择那个数字 。 答案2022-03-09: 容易想到二分法,但二分法是不对的。 递归或动态规划。 只有1个数字的时候,返回0。...大于等于3个数字的时候,每一个都试一下。 代码用golang编写。

31810

盘点Random类常用方法并用其实现一个数字游戏

二、数字游戏 1.设计一个范围在1-100之间的数字游戏。...<num){//如果用户输入的数字小于机器人的数字,打印你的数字小了 System.out.println("你的数字小了"); }else{...从上面代码中,首先是创建Scanner对象用来接受用户的输入,定义生成一个随机int类型的值,这个值是作为机器人的数字。通过while循环判断,当用户输入的数字大于机器人数字,表示的数字大了。...四、总结 本文主要介绍了Random类常用的方法、数字游戏、Date类。...数字游戏主要是设计一个范围在1-100之间的数字,巩固前面所学的知识点。对于Date类只要了解如何通过创建对象封装时间就可以了。希望大家通过本文的学习,对你有所帮助!

53920

手把手教你创建一个数字游戏!小白专属~

建立数字游戏所需要的知识有:循环和函数,只要了解这两个知识点,就可以搭建这样一个简易而又有趣的小游戏!...2加入菜单 相信大家都玩过单机小游戏,我们首先接触到的就是菜单,菜单中有基本的选项:选择游戏或者退出游戏,因此我们需要一个菜单,也就是menu函数(在do while循环中加入)。...}while(input); return 0; } ​ 3加入随机数函数 既然是数字游戏,那么我们需要一个函数来生成随机数,在cplusplus中搜索rand()函数,我们可以了解它的使用方法...因此,我们需要添加一个switch函数,来完成以上目的。...快跟我一起数字吧(doge),赌狗的游戏~~~~

7310

借助大模型,扣字就能创造一个关卡类小游戏

上一篇,我们讲过如何通过简单的角色设定,让元器帮我们生成一个“星座大师”智能体,难道prompt的能力只在这里?我们是否能够发挥想象力,使用prompt,让元器帮助我们创建一个游戏的智能体。...那谈到游戏, 我们首先得想我们和智能体的沟通界面,我们不妨把他当做一个即时通讯的“聊天窗口”,不过它可能比女神回复你要快的多?...我们不妨打开一个游戏智能体看看:那很简单,在开始前,我们需要给到用户一个背景介绍,那就是我们是个什么样的游戏,用户需要做什么,刚好庆余年第二季刚播完,我们不妨畅想一下,范闲创神庙,那么我们开始遍背景,他可以是...那交代完背景之后,我们剩下的只是游戏设置了,首先闯神庙,那么神庙是什么?##神庙设定神庙的设定古老遗迹:神庙是一个古老的遗迹,存在于庆国的边境地区。...最后,我们来调试一下:看,我们获得了一个多么敬职的游戏智能体,走都不让走!

5810

前端: 用javascript实现一个转盘小游戏?

本文主要介绍如何使用原生javascript和Css3来实现一个在各大移动应用中经常出现的转盘游戏,由于改实现可以有不同方式,如果熟悉canvas的话也可以用canvas实现,本文采用js和css实现主要考虑到复杂度较小性能较好...前言 本文技术路线采用和上篇文章教你用200行代码写一个爱豆拼拼乐H5小游戏(附源码)同样的技术,即均使用本人自己写的dom库去简化dom操作,具体需要掌握的知识点有: css3 背景渐变,transform...,transition less循环的使用 javascript基本随机算法 文档片段 documentFragment的使用 由于文章没有太高深的技术,关键是思路,所以接下来开始我们的实现介绍。...piece-@{n} { transform: rotate(-30deg * (@n + 1)); } } .loop(11); } 2.javascript...如果想体验实际案例效果和技术交流,或者感受更多原创h5游戏源码,可以关注哦

1.4K10

听说Python基础不好的人都无法写出来的一个游戏数字!

前言 不要小看这个简简单单的数字小游戏,它可是涉及到很多的基础知识点的:input函数、字符串、while循环、if条件判断语句、break语句。...那让我们来由浅入深的讲讲本次的案例 游戏介绍:程序自己有一个数字,用户输入一个数字,两个数字进行比较。...输入一个数字 you_num = input("请输入一个数字:") you_num = int(you_num) 3....数字结果 # 一个等于号是复制符号 两个等于号才是等于号 print(my_num, you_num) print(type(my_num), type(you_num)) # 不同类型之间,肯定是不会相等的...下面的就开始升级了,能一直,直到猜对为止 升级版 如果我要三次、N次,直到猜对位置 times = 1 while True: print(f'开始第 {times} 次数字')

28830

Python基础第一个案例:数字游戏,这个都写不出,那就放弃吧

游戏介绍: 程序自己有一个数字,用户输入一个数字,两个数字进行比较。 知识点: input函数 字符串 while循环 if条件判断语句 break语句 开始撸代码 先来看看效果图 代码 # 1....有一个数字 my_num = 5 # 2. 输入一个数字 you_num = input("请输入一个数字:") you_num = int(you_num) # 3....数字结果 # 一个等于号是复制符号 两个等于号才是等于号 print(my_num, you_num) print(type(my_num), type(you_num)) # 不同类型之间,肯定是不会相等的...{times} 次数字') you_num = input("请输入一个数字(1-10):") # 如果输入的内容不是一个数字 if you_num.isdigit():...+= 1 else: print('输入错误,请输入一个数字') 效果图 来一个最终版本的 # random 是一个内置的随机函数模块 import random my_num

47210

Javascript和css3实现一个转盘小游戏

本文主要介绍如何使用原生javascript和Css3来实现一个在各大移动应用中经常出现的转盘游戏,由于改实现可以有不同方式,如果熟悉canvas的话也可以用canvas实现,本文采用js和css实现主要考虑到复杂度较小性能较好...前言 本文技术路线采用和上篇文章教你用200行代码写一个爱豆拼拼乐H5小游戏(附源码)同样的技术,即均使用本人自己写的dom库去简化dom操作,具体需要掌握的知识点有: css3 背景渐变,transform...,transition less循环的使用 javascript基本随机算法 文档片段 documentFragment的使用 由于文章没有太高深的技术,关键是思路,所以接下来开始我们的实现介绍。...piece-@{n} { transform: rotate(-30deg * (@n + 1)); } } .loop(11); } 2.javascript...如果想体验实际案例效果和技术交流,或者感受更多原创h5游戏demo,可以关注下方公众号体验哦 更多推荐 教你用200行代码写一个爱豆拼拼乐H5小游戏(附源码) 基于react/vue生态的前端集成解决方案探索与总结

2.7K20

使用 HTML、CSS、JavaScript 创建一个简单的井字游戏

使用 javascript 创建游戏是最有趣的学习方式。它会让你保持动力,这对于学习 Web 开发等复杂技能至关重要。...在今天的博文中,我们将使用 HTML、CSS 和 Javascript 创建一个井字游戏。...在显示中,我们有一个包含X或O取决于当前用户的跨度。我们将类应用于此跨度以对文本进行着色。 第三部分是拿着游戏板的部分。它有一个container类,因此我们可以正确放置瓷砖。...默认情况下它是空的,我们将从 javascript 修改它的内容。 最后一部分将保存我们的控件,其中包含一个重新开始按钮。...此函数将接收一个 tile 和一个索引作为参数。当用户单击一个图块时,将调用此函数。首先我们需要检查它是否是一个有效的动作,我们还将检查游戏当前是否处于活动状态。

1.9K21
领券